新闻资讯
看你所看,想你所想

信息系统开发方法教程(第四版)

信息系统开发方法教程(第四版)

信息系统开发方法教程(第四版)

《信息系统开发方法教程(第四版)》是2014年清华大学出版社出版的图书。

基本介绍

  • 书名:信息系统开发方法教程(第四版)
  • ISBN:9787302336723
  • 定价:35元
  • 装帧:平装
  • 印次:4-2
  • 印刷日期:2014-12-24

图书简介

本书全面地介绍信息系统开发中的基本概念、基本工作原理、开发思想和开发方法,引入了CMM概念,系统地介绍信息系统开发过程中的项目管理;结合实际案例系统介绍以数据规划为核心的信息系统总体规划方法,在需求分析阶段实现由业务过程向面向对象分析的过渡,并在系统分析、设计、测试阶段,以面向对象技术和UML为基础系统地介绍开发方法和工作思路。本书力求理论与实际的有机结合,使开发方法具有较强的可操作性,指导开发人员能够构建一个性能良好、实用、可修改、可扩充的信息系统,并为信息资源的开发和利用奠定良好的基础。本书还提供了与之配套的电子版开发文档、源程式代码和教学课件,以方便教学。

目录

第1章信息系统基本概念1
1.1信息的基本概念1
1.1.1数据与信息1
1.1.2信息的特性2
1.1.3信息的生命阶段4
1.2信息系统的基本概念9
1.2.1系统的概念9
1.2.2信息系统11
1.3信息系统的开发19
1.3.1信息系统开发中常见的一些问题20
1.3.2系统的方法21
1.3.3系统开发步骤23
1.3.4信息系统开发的基本原理和基本观点27
1.4信息系统开发的组织及项目管理29
1.4.1信息系统开发人员的组织30
1.4.2系统分析员应具有的基本技能31
1.4.3信息系统开发中的文档管理32
1.4.4信息系统开发中的项目管理35
1.5原型法40
1.5.1原型法开发步骤40
1.5.2原型法的使用前提42
1.5.3原型法的人员组织和工作环境43
思考题44
第2章信息系统开发过程管理45
2.1CMM概述45
2.1.1CMM基本概念45
2.1.2CMM框架47
2.1.3CMM管理手段53
2.2信息系统开发过程模型55
2.2.1常用的开发模型55
2.2.2CMM中的开发流程定义58
2.2.3CMM中的开发流程裁剪64
2.3信息系统开发过程中的标準规範66
2.3.1过程文档的标準规範66
2.3.2开发文档的标準规範68
2.3.3程式编制的标準规範69
思考题69
第3章信息系统总体规划70
3.1信息系统总体规划概述70
3.1.1问题的提出70
3.1.2总体规划的时机73
3.1.3总体规划的内容74
3.1.4总体规划的组织75
3.1.5总体规划的步骤77
3.2数据环境79
3.2.1建立资料库的必要性79
3.2.2四类数据环境79
3.2.3主题资料库规划的内容80
3.3总体业务规划82
3.3.1现行系统的调查82
3.3.2职能域84
3.3.3业务过程85
3.3.4业务活动88
3.3.5业务模型的最佳化91
3.4总体数据规划96
3.4.1主题资料库规划96
3.4.2信息系统总体结构规划97
3.4.3主题资料库的分布规划104
3.4.4主题资料库的可靠性规划107
3.5信息技术规划107
3.5.1关键技术套用规划107
3.5.2套用开发策略规划110
3.5.3数据管理策略112
3.5.4硬体基础设施规划113
3.5.5开发工具的选择策略114
思考题115
第4章业务流程及功能需求分析116
4.1需求调查概述116
4.1.1良好需求的特徵116
4.1.2需求调查的步骤及工作产品118
4.1.3需求调查前的準备120
4.2业务流程调查121
4.2.1业务流程图绘製标準121
4.2.2业务流程概要调查122
4.2.3业务流程详细调查124
4.2.4业务流程审查与确认128
4.3功能需求分析131
4.3.1需求分析文档标準131
4.3.2需求分析135
4.3.3用例模型的建立及检验141
4.4功能描述146
4.4.1用例的活动图描述146
4.4.2状态图151
4.4.3用例说明152
4.4.4情景描述板161
思考题162
第5章系统分析建模163
5.1系统分析概述163
5.1.1系统分析任务及步骤163
5.1.2系统分析的工作产品164
5.1.3系统分析的特点166
5.2过程建模及用例模型设计167
5.2.1详细的功能分析及过程建模167
5.2.2过程模型的审查与确认172
5.2.3用例模型的设计174
5.3时序分析178
5.3.1时序图製作规範178
5.3.2功能需求的时序描述180
5.3.3时序描述的检验187
5.4类分析模型187
5.4.1系统分析中的常用类及关係188
5.4.2时序图向类分析模型的转换189
5.4.3构建类分析模型193
5.5数据建模196
5.5.1关係的基本性质及规範化形式196
5.5.2数据分析建立数据模型200
5.5.3信息分类编码设计204
思考题211
第6章信息系统设计212
6.1信息系统设计概述212
6.1.1功能设计的基本任务212
6.1.2系统设计评价标準214
6.1.3系统设计的步骤及工作产品218
6.2系统架构设计及资料库物理设计219
6.2.1系统架构简介219
6.2.2系统架构的选择222
6.2.3系统架构的配置224
6.3系统界面设计226
6.3.1输入输出方式226
6.3.2操作模式的设计228
6.3.3C/S与B/S中界面设计比较230
6.3.4互动界面设计231
6.4系统功能设计235
6.4.1系统互动设计236
6.4.2系统流程对象设计237
6.4.3系统实体对象设计240
6.5持久化设计242
6.5.1资料库物理设计242
6.5.2对象的持久化245
6.6程式设计247
6.6.1面向对象功能设计方法248
6.6.2面向对象的程式代码设计255
6.7系统实现264
6.7.1系统配置及设定265
6.7.2系统的部署265
思考题268
第7章系统测试269
7.1系统测试概述269
7.1.1测试的基本方法269
7.1.2测试的基本原则271
7.1.3测试内容及测试手段273
7.2人工测试方法274
7.2.1程式审查会275
7.2.2人工运行277
7.2.3静态检验277
7.3测试用例的设计278
7.3.1测试用例的设计步骤278
7.3.2白盒测试280
7.3.3黑盒测试283
7.3.4测试用例设计策略292
7.4单元测试和集成测试293
7.4.1单元测试293
7.4.2集成测试294
7.4.3测试的执行295
7.5高级测试296
7.5.1系统测试296
7.5.2验收测试及安装测试298
7.6测试计画和控制298
7.6.1测试计画299
7.6.2测试完成的标準299
思考题301
第8章系统运行维护302
8.1系统切换302
8.1.1系统切换前的準备302
8.1.2系统切换303
8.2系统运行维护304
8.2.1系统运行304
8.2.2系统维护306
8.3系统运行的审计与评价308
思考题310
附录A程式代码编写规範示例311
A.1排版311
A.2注释313
A.3命名314
附录BRationalRose使用方法简介316
B.1RationalRose的启动316
B.2用例图317
B.3类图319
B.4状态图321
B.5顺序图322
B.5.1初始顺序图322
B.5.2将对象映射类324
B.5.3将讯息映射到方法324
参考文献327

相关推荐

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:yongganaa@126.com